India is the world’s largest whiskey consumer (1.9 billion litres in 2020) and is also a rising consumer of wine. India is undergoing an evolution in its drinking culture and trends abound, providing a wealth of opportunities for alcoholic beverage exports from the United States.

To capture some of this impressive throat share, FAS New Delhi recently packed the house at its ‘Taste of the Mid-West’ distilled spirits promotion programme at the Fig&Maple.

Nearly 100 key importers, distributors, retailers, press/media, food and beverage managers, and top social media influencers came out for a taste of spectacular, uniquely crafted mid-Western American spirits.

FAS New Delhi showcased never-before-seen premium whiskey and spirits from select Mid-West distilleries in Iowa, Wisconsin, Illinois, Michigan, and Montana.

The newly arrived Chargé d’Affaires, Patricia Lacina, an Iowa native, hosted the tastings alongside FAS New Delhi’s Mariano J. Beillard and Mark Rosmann, even preparing a specially crafted Old-Fashioned cocktail using Templeton Rye whiskey!

It’s the Golden Age of American spirits, with the versatility and quality of US bourbons, rye whiskeys, and other spirits coming barrelling through at the tasting stations, facilitating buyer/seller interaction and generating US exports.

FAS New Delhi and Mumbai this fall are rolling out US spirits and wine promotion tastings to entice new buyers.
